This package of course provides the source code for a generic USB CCID (Chip/Smart Card Interface Devices) driver.

Supported smartcard readers are:
- Advanced Card Systems ACR 38 [16]
- Cherry XX33 keyboard [?]
- Dell keyboard SK-3106 [?]
- Dell smart card reader keyboard [?]
- Gemplus GemPC 433 SL [2]
- Gemplus GemPC Key [3]
- Gemplus GemPC Twin [4]
- Kobil KAAN Base [19]
- Kobil KAAN Advanced [20]
- Kobil KAAN SIM III [21]
- Kobil KAAN mIDentity [22]
- OmniKey CardMan 3121 [5]
- SCM Micro SCR 331 [6]
- SCM Micro SCR 331-DI [11]
- SCM Micro SCR 335 [7]
- SCM Micro SCR 3310
- SCM Micro SPR 532 [9]
- Cherry XX44 keyboard (SmartBoard G83-6744) [18]
- ActivCard USB reader 2.0 [10]
- C3PO LTC32 [13]
- SCM Micro SCR 333 [15]
- Silitek SK-3105 keyboard [12] or C3PO TLTC2USB [14]
